Mary I of England

Mary I (18 February 1516 – 17 November 1558) was Queen of England and Queen of Ireland from 19 July 1553 until her death in 1558. She was the eldest daughter of Henry VIII and the only surviving child of Catherine of Aragon. On 17 November 1558, she was killed by the Assassins, and succeeded by her younger half-sister, Elizabeth.
